Eyal Levy is the founder and CEO of Banana Exchange. Banana Exchange is a factoring company that provides capital to Merchant Cash Advance (MCA) funding companies. Currently he is a mentor in the Harvard Business School Entrepreneurship Program.
Top 3 Value Bombs
1. Be patient. There are so many obstacles in creating something new. Only those who have the stamina to continue will succeed.
2. As entrepreneurs, it’s our duty to help other entrepreneurs shine.
3. Every child that was born today all over the world has the potential of becoming an entrepreneur. But, the system we live in prohibits most of them from becoming one.
